What Is It?

The first thing you definitely need and want to know is what a contractor’s license bond really is, so let me offer an explanation right here. This is actually a type of a surety bond and it represents an agreement between three parties, i.e. the contractor, the entity that’s requiring it and that’s usually the state, and the provider. It acts as a guarantee that you will comply with all the rules and regulations set forward by your local authorities.

In addition to making sure that you will oblige to the rules, or specifically because of that, these also serve to protect your clients, as they will offer them a type of a guarantee that you will do the best possible work with the project that they’ve hired you for. So, when you get a guarantee like this, you will certainly start getting even more clients, since a lot of people will refuse to work with those companies that aren’t licensed or insured this way. Do You Need It?

The real question here is not whether you understand the benefits of doing this. The question is actually whether you need to get a contractor’s license bond. Is it required in California? Well, when word goes of California, let me tell you right away that this is a requirement instead of an option and that you most certainly need to carry a &15000 contractor’s license bond. So, in addition to being beneficial, we cannot fail to mention that it is also obligatory.
